Skukuza Rest Camp is situated in the Kruger National Park area. Guests are provided with a selection of accommodation options, including safari tents, guest houses, campsites, bungalows and cottages. There are 2 on-site restaurants available to guests. Additional facilities include a shop, a communal kitchen area, communal ablution areas for the campsites, 2 swimming pools and a laundry.

Satara Rest Camp is located in Kruger National Park, known for its excellent game viewing opportunities. Nearby attractions include the Sweni and Ratel Pan bird hides. The camp offers various room amenities such as air-conditioning and kitchenettes. Dining options include a restaurant and a deli. Leisure facilities feature a swimming pool, a children’s playground, and communal kitchens. The camp also provides guided bush walks, game drives, and wildlife films in the evenings.

Letaba Rest Camp, located on a bend of the Letaba River in the Kruger National Park, offers comfortable accommodation options, including guest houses, cottages, bungalows, huts, and furnished safari tents. The camp is known for its game-viewing and bird-watching opportunities. Visitors can enjoy guided game drives, bush walks, and bush braais with trained field guides. Amenities include a restaurant, a cafeteria, a shop and a laundromat.

Mabalauta Developed Campsite is among the limited number of developed campsites in Gonarezhou National Park, characterized by the presence of ablution facilities. Although these facilities across the park are somewhat worn, they remain operational. The park’s staff maintains a donkey geyser that heats the water. Nestled on the banks of the Mwenezi River, this camp exudes a unique charm and is shaded by large trees. The sites are roomy, each equipped with a braai pit, a tap, and a cement table with chairs.

The Chipinda Pools Tented Camp, a fantastic and excellent value for money facility was completed in July 2012 through funding provided by the Frankfurt Zoological Society as part of the Gonarezhou Conservation Project and comprises four extremely spacious East African style tents. Two of the tents have a double bed and two stretcher beds and two of the tents have a double bed and two single beds allowing one plenty of flexibility for families. Each tent has an en suite bathroom (with solar geysers providing copious amounts of piping hot water) at the back of each tent and a large covered veranda at the front. The camp is located high up on the banks of the Runde River offering views over extensive Phragmites reedbeds frequented by elephants. The riverine fringe provides excellent birding and with some luck one might get a sighting of one of the resident Pel’s Fishing Owls. Game in the vicinity of the camp is extremely relaxed with groups of nyala, kudu, impala and elephant happily passing through camp.

Overlooking the ancient city and a valley of msasa trees, Lodge At The Ancient City offers accommodation located in Masvingo, Zimbabwe. The property features 19 thatched bungalows decorated with authentic artefacts. Each bungalow features an overhead fan, a minibar, tea/coffee-making facilities, a TV with DStv, and Wi-Fi. Guests can conveniently enjoy meals at the on-site restaurant. Additional amenities include a bar and a pool. Local activities include boat cruises, guided tours of rock art and caves, game viewing, birding, fishing and community visits.

Matobo Hills Lodge is situated within a private wildlife reserve bordering Matobo National Park (50km from Bulawayo). Matopos hills is an area of exquisite beauty, the lodge's accommodation units are built upon a granite outcrop with sweeping panoramic views over the surrounding hills. There is a separate lounge/bar which commands spectacular 360-degree views of Mount Ififi and the Maleme Valley.
In an area of exquisite beauty, the lodge's accommodation units are built upon a granite outcrop with outlooks over the surrounding hills. 34 beds in seventeen luxury hilltop lodges; 13 twin bedded and 4 double bedded. All lodges have shower, bath toilet and basin and wall-to-wall carpet. Extra beds on request.

A small intimate lodge featuring 7 luxurious tree houses and 2 Presidential Elephant Suites set on elevated platforms amongst the indigenous flora of Hwange Game Park.
Deep in the mystical teak forests of Hwange is this unobtrusive camp, bathed in the tales of pioneering hunters and explorers such as Fredrick Courtney Selous. Lumbering giants drift around your stilted platforms , their tusks glinting in salute to the sanctuary of shade offered up by these massive trees.
This is Ivory Lodge – place of elephants. It is here that great herds of elephants are found – sometimes over 100 strong.
Hwange is renowned for its huge tuskers – big old bulls with magnificent tusks. It is also here that the famous Presidential Herd drinks – these elephants’ home-range is amongst the dense feeding areas of the Sikumi Vlei and where they find refuge from the scorching heat at Ivory’s water hole.

Bayete offers comfortable and affordable accommodation and is situated in the heart of the Victoria Falls Residential Area. The lodge is 2 km away from the Victoria Falls Centre and 22 km from the airport. Recently renovated, this family run lodge has 25 rooms which is set in a lush tropical garden. Central to the lodge is the large tear drop pool which is hugged by the Caldecott Boma and Ngwezi Tavern. Breakfast is served in the Caldecott Boma every day. Lunch and dinner are also available on special request and are delicious home cooked meals. Buffets and BBQ’s are available for group bookings or by special request.
